When does the event take place? In 2023, the Noblegarden Festival takes place from April 10 at 10:00 AM to April 17 at 09:59 AM.

Noblegarden Festival – New reward for 2023

The Noblegarden Festival 2023 is the first in the Dragonflight expansion. There is only one new reward, but it is compatible with all your dragons. For the price of 200 Noblegarden chocolates, you can buy the toy “A Dragon’s Basket with Eggs” from the Noblegarden Festival merchants.

The toy grants you a buff for 15 minutes when used. As long as you are in the air with the dragon, it carries a large basket with eggs in its mouth.

What do you need to do during the Noblegarden Festival? Even though the Noblegarden Festival is considered one of the “big” annual events, the process here is quite simple, as there is basically only one necessary task to secure various rewards: Collecting eggs.

Each egg found can be opened and rewards you with a piece of Noblegarden chocolate. This chocolate can then be exchanged at a vendor for numerous rewards. The prices for the various rewards range from 5 chocolates to 500 chocolates.

WoW Noblegarden Festival Merchant
Merchants and quest givers can be found in every known starting area.

The trick with collecting the eggs is that the eggs – in addition to the chocolate – can also contain some of the rewards. So you are unlikely to have to collect several thousand pieces of chocolate, but will already receive some of the cool rewards while searching.

Where can you collect the eggs? Collecting colorful eggs can be done in all cities of the respective starting areas.

These are for the Alliance:

  • Azulwacht (Azurmyth Islands)
  • Dolanaar (Teldrassil)
  • Goldshire (Elwynn Forest)
  • Kharanos (Dun Morogh)

These are for the Horde:

  • Bloodhoof Village (Mulgore)
  • Brill (Tirisfal)
  • Falkenwing Place (Eastern Plaguelands)
  • Bladefist Mountain (Durotar)

The eggs are “hidden” everywhere in the outdoor area of each location. Since they are quite colorful, you should spot them quickly. Generally, they also respawn within a few seconds.

WoW Noblegarden Festival Eggs
The eggs are quite large and colorful – you can hardly miss them.

Keep in mind that you can find the eggs in all possible “versions” of the villages. For example, you can activate the War Mode when the location is otherwise overcrowded with players or activate an alternate Chromie timeline with a character below level 60 to have less competition while searching for eggs.

Tip for collecting: If you want to collect eggs faster and more successfully, you should also assign the interaction key in the options. Then you don’t have to search for and click on the eggs painstakingly, but can simply walk near them and pick them up with a key press. We’ve explained how to assign an interaction key here.

What rewards are available? The Noblegarden Festival offers a total of 21 different rewards that you can buy for Noblegarden chocolates. If you want all the rewards in simple form, you would need to collect a whopping 2015 eggs.

However, keep in mind that the amount will decrease significantly, as you will already receive many of the rewards from the eggs beforehand. Additionally, it’s possible to buy the most expensive reward – the mount “Swift Springstrider” – from other players at the auction house instead of spending the 500 chocolates for it.

What was this survey about? On April 6, 2023 Pokémon GO officially introduced the much-discussed changes to remote raids. Among other things, the prices of the necessary passes were increased:

  • Three remote raid passes now cost 525 PokéCoins instead of 300 PokéCoins
  • The price of a single remote raid pass has been increased from 100 PokéCoins to 195 PokéCoins

Additionally, a new premium battle pass bundle for local raids was introduced. It costs 250 coins for 3 local passes, while a single one costs 100.

Furthermore, the use of remote raid passes has been limited to 5 per day. At the same time, there is now also a chance to get remote raid passes as rewards from research breakthroughs.

What is behind the rabbit event? From April 12th to April 25th, the Easter event will be active. It revolves around rabbits that have been corrupted by Azoth and have become stronger as a result. They are located in all areas and can usually be dispatched with a single attack. You can find all the important spawn points here:

New World: Where to find rabbits?

Just like last year, you can find items for higher drop chances, a chest with 1050 storage space in your own house, and gypsum from the rabbits. Additionally, there is a new skin for the headpiece. However, this year, there is a guaranteed drop when you kill enough rabbits.

400 rabbits for more storage

What do the drop chances look like?

  • The diamond gypsum has a drop probability of 66%. You can find a maximum of 6 gypsum per day.
  • The corrupted rabbit’s paw has a drop probability of 80% and you can find a maximum of 5 per day.
  • The corrupted rabbit mask is the new head skin and has a drop probability of 0.5%. However, you will receive the mask guaranteed after you kill 200 rabbits. Here you can only get one mask during the entire event.
  • The corrupted rabbit’s storage chest is the grand prize of the event. The drop probability is only 0.25%. However, after 400 killed rabbits, you will receive the chest guaranteed. Here, you can only get one per event.

The daily rewards are reset at 5:00 AM German time.

Is the event worth it? Sort of. Those who still need to upgrade their equipment should farm the 6 gypsum daily to either gain competency or further shadow shards. The chest is also a useful addition to your own house, which is definitely worth it.

Since Patch 10.0, there has been an option for the “Interact Key,” which I want to recommend to you.

Where can you find the setting? Simply press the Escape key, select “Options,” and then the “Controls” subsection. Now scroll down a bit and check the box for “Enable Interaction Key.” Then assign a corresponding key for “Interact With Target” in the menu directly below.

For most, the “F” key would be suitable here, but the choice is of course up to you.

WoW Interaction Key Options
A somewhat “hidden” setting with a significant effect.

What does the setting do? You only notice how great the setting is over the course of days and weeks. But let me give you a few examples.

Currently, the Noblegarden festival is taking place. This is the Easter event of World of Warcraft. Here you can collect eggs in various cities that you need for achievements and rewards. The catch: Everyone else is collecting the eggs too, and only the first person to click the egg gets the loot. With the Interaction Key, you are faster than anyone who has to click the egg manually.

Do you remember those quests where you have to rescue small animals like squirrels that dart across the screen in a panic? Usually, you run after them like crazy, trying to wildly click them 30 times just to complete the quest after 10 minutes of frustration. That’s no longer necessary. Because the Interaction Key also eliminates this problem.

Fishing becomes significantly easier with this.

The function is even suitable for bypassing bugs in World of Warcraft. Do you also know that sometimes an ore or a treasure chest spawns “in the ground” and cannot be clicked? With the interaction key, you can avoid this problem too. Especially in Dragonflight with the “Moving Earth,” this is quite valuable.

Whether you want to talk to NPCs, pick up a quest item, or open a door – with the Interaction Key, you save yourself the hassle of moving the mouse and ensure that even the smallest objects are hit.

The MMORPG Tibia was created in 1995 in Regensburg. Because the developers have always gone their own way, there are very bizarre stories from the online role-playing game. One of the most exciting stories emerged in 2005: the Regensburg team put a door in their MMORPG that no one would open for 11 years.

What is special about Tibia?

  • Tibia is an MMORPG from a different time that doesn’t follow a clear blueprint like later MMORPGs. Modern MMORPGs were oriented towards Everquest and wanted to be as fair and standardized as possible. But the developers of Tibia were 4 students from Regensburg who just went for it.
  • They built in some secrets and unique items into their game, which is not something you see today.
  • One of the biggest secrets was a door.
Start video
5 old MMORPGs that are still actively played

Developers build a door in their MMORPG, through which no one may pass for 11 years

What kind of door was it? In 2005, the developers added a door to their MMORPG with the inscription: “You see a gate of expertise for level 999. Only the worthy may pass.”

The developers said in an interview with Vice that it was actually just a gag, and for a long time, there was nothing behind this door.

Because level 999 was completely illusory in 2005. No one would reach that for 10 years, one knew. Especially since in Tibia you can even lose experience points and levels if you die.

But after 2005, Tibia continued to grow, the game got bigger and bigger, players leveled up higher and higher, and by 2016 it was time.

tibia-portal

Player becomes a star by reaching level 999 first

A player, Kharsek, had leveled up like crazy for 9 years, becoming the star of the game that everyone knew. Now Kharsek was approaching the magical level 999. Everyone was sure: He would soon unveil the secret of the magical door.

This was a big deal at the time. The site 3dJuegos writes there were two groups of players:

  • One group helped Kharsek collect as many experience points as possible. He should finally reach level 999 so that everyone would finally learn what was behind the damn door.
  • Another group wanted to prevent that, chasing him, killing his spawns right in front of him, or sending mobs against his healer.

Player unveils the secret but simply tells no one

So the opening went: Ultimately, the player reached level 999 in August 2016, and the players of Tibia were excited to finally find out what was behind the door.

A user on reddit wrote at the time:

I’ve never heard of the game in my life, but the most important thing in my life right now is that this stupid bastard opens the stupid door.

Already in 2016, there were things like Twitch and YouTube, and everyone expected to either be present live at the reveal of the big secret or to find out within hours.

Kharsek opened the door, saw what was behind it, logged out, stayed offline, and told no soul what was behind the door. Even when he later returned to Tibia, he said nothing about the door.

The community was in an uproar. After waiting patiently for 11 years, they still learned nothing. There were many theories about what could be behind the door: treasure chests, NPCs, maybe levers and secret stuff.

But Kharsek remained silent, the developers never said anything anyway, and it remained a secret.

A year later, a Twitch streamer says: I will open the door if you pay for my vacation

And what was really behind the door? It took almost a year until June 2017, when the next player reached level 999. He wanted to make the most of the moment, started a Twitch stream, and said: He would only open the door if the viewers paid for his vacation to Morocco: he wanted to earn $500, but not enough money was raised. With just $33, he passed through the portal.

Recommended editorial content

At this point you will find external content from YouTube that complements the article.

I consent to external content being displayed to me. Personal data can be transmitted to third party platforms. Read more about our privacy policy.
Link to the YouTube content

Ultimately, the player went through the door and found a portal to a tropical island with some nice items and a golden trophy with the inscription “Congratulations on reaching level 999.”

It would have probably been cooler if the door had remained a secret forever.

The expectations that had built up over 12 years could probably never have been met.

APB: All Points Bulletin (2010, PC) was an MMO shooter that involved huge amounts of money in its development. The game was supposed to reinvent the “online shooter” genre as a sandbox game. In the end, however, it became one of the biggest flops in gaming history.

What kind of game is APB: All Points Bulletin? APB: All Points Bulletin was released in 2010 and was an MMO shooter with a real-time game world.

Two factions were at the center, with players able to choose a side:

  • Enforcers, who upheld the law
  • Criminals, who engaged in illegal activities

There were missions where both sides fought each other. The player had to complete tasks while the opponents attempted to stop them.

The article was originally published in August 2022 and was updated for you in April 2023.

Here you can see a trailer for APB: All Points Bulletin:

Start video
APB: All Points Bulletin – Erster offizieller Trailer

Who is behind the development of APB: All Points Bulletin? In 2002, the creator of the Grand Theft Auto series, David Jones, founded the game studio Realtime Worlds.

Crackdown was the studio’s first game and was released in 2007. The player took on the role of an agent with superhuman abilities due to biological enhancements, combating crime in a futuristic city.

The studio was able to build on the success of Crackdown and approached the development of a new game with more budget and a larger team: APB: All Points Bulletin.

“The development costs amounted to over 100 million dollars, making it one of the most expensive video games in history”

The development of the game took 5 years. In addition to its own funds, the studio was able to secure significant investor sums.

What was APB: All Points Bulletin supposed to offer the player? APB was announced in 2005, with a release planned for 2008. The game studio aimed to uniquely renew the “online shooter in a sandbox” genre with this game.

The game promised a massive world with extensive content and allowed players to customize their characters in numerous ways.

Character design was one of the main focuses of the APB developers. At the same time, grinding was intended to be perceived not as a task but as fun gameplay.

By “sandbox,” we mean games that give players enormous freedom and allow them to play as they wish — without many quests or a storyline. The player is supposed to engage in the “sandbox” and express their creativity. Well-known sandbox games include Minecraft, The Sims, Mount & Blade, or GTA 5 Online.

What caused APB: All Points Bulletin to fail? The game launched 2 years late in 2010. It followed with criticism from players:

  • First and foremost, the shooting gameplay and the use of vehicles were criticized.
  • Actions in the game felt unfluid, and the game responded sluggishly at times.
  • There were also issues with matchmaking.

Many felt that the game needed more time in development.

Here you can find the English video from GVMERS about APB: All Points Bulletin, which tells the background story of APB-All Points Bulletin:

Recommended editorial content

At this point you will find external content from YouTube that complements the article.

I consent to external content being displayed to me. Personal data can be transmitted to third party platforms. Read more about our privacy policy.
Link to the YouTube content

Too much money and too high expectations

What could have caused the internal failure? Among other things, the studio cited the following issues: According to a former employee, the problems in the gameplay were known to the developers. Beta testers had already pointed out the difficulties in the game, which were not addressed. They relied more on David Jones’s assessment than on external feedback.

An interesting problem was raised by Nicholas Lovell. The business blogger from Gamesbrief argued that too much money was available and nobody knew how to use it effectively. A problem that many startups with high financial means may have faced (via the guardian.com).

The expectations for APB were high, and everyone expected a worthy successor in the style of GTA. Aspects that, according to David Jones, ultimately led to false impressions and high demands (via eurogamer.net)

Mission in APB: All Points Bulletin, Source: YouTube

How was APB: All Points Bulletin and its remake rated by players? On metacritic, the game has a user score of 5.7 (10 is the highest score).

Since the rating also includes comments made after the server shutdown of APB: All Points Bulletin, they likely refer to the remake and not solely the original game.

The APB games seem to be polarizing. Of the total 294 ratings, only 28 are mixed. 126 ratings are negative and 140 positive:

The user TonyJ wrote on June 30, 2010: “It really has the potential to be a great game. The customization options are ridiculous. Last night I crafted a piece of clothing that looks exactly like what they sell in my college bookstore. Right now there are still some bugs, especially performance issues. It seems that [the performance of your system] has no impact on whether you can run the game correctly or not. RTW says they are working on the problem, but it has been known for a few weeks. The gameplay is fun. Driving an ambulance and running over opponents while your friends dangle out of the windows and doors gets the blood pumping.”

On the other hand, criticism was voiced by MikeP on June 29, 2010: “This is a terrible game. The driving, which I was looking forward to the most, is so sloppy and responds so poorly that it feels like steering a brick on a tricycle. This game was a huge disappointment, and I wish I hadn’t wasted my money. There’s a reason there are no reviews yet.”

The Legacy of APB: All Points Bulletin

What happened to the game studio Realtime Worlds? With the flop of APB: All Points Bulletin, the game studio of David Jones also descended.

Employees were laid off, and the upcoming project was canceled – the game studio went bankrupt. Allegedly, there were issues with paying salaries (via gamedeveloper.com).

On September 23, 2010, APB: All Points Bulletin went offline. APB was taken over by publisher K2 Network, who had also been responsible for “War Rock” (via eurogamer.net).

On the APB website, it states: “The development costs amounted to over 100 million dollars [approximately 98 million euros], making it one of the most expensive video games in history.” (via apb.com)

What happened to APB: All Points Bulletin? Under K2 Network and the production company Reloaded Productions came the remake titled APB: Reloaded.

David Jones advised the project. APB: Reloaded also failed to meet Jones’s high expectations but was more successful than its predecessor.

In 2019, Unit Game purchased the copyright from APB. According to the APB website, Unit Game had plans for the development of further APB games.

With the upcoming patch 10.1, World of Warcraft will receive a new area and a new raid. A mechanic from 18 years ago, the famous “Class Calls” by Nefarian, was expected to return. However, according to the latest information, Blizzard has decided against it, despite the fact that sound files had already been recorded.

What sort of mechanic is that? The “Class Calls” were a completely unique mechanic in Blackwing Lair. The final boss Nefarian would choose a player and take control of them.

These players would harm their own group with their abilities. Depending on the class, different effects occurred – rogues, for example, would poison almost the entire raid. The mechanic was so special, that new classes received a call in the ancient raid years later.

With patch 10.1 “Ashes of Neltharion”, the Class Calls were supposed to return, and that directly for all 13 classes. Even the sound files that the dragon would shout to announce the class already exist. That now looks different.

This is new now: As wowhead has discovered, the entry for the Class Calls has disappeared from the dungeon journal. This means that the ability is no longer listed, so it likely won’t be used anymore.

At the moment, the patch is still being tested and changes can constantly occur. However, it looks like at least this mechanic has now been scrapped.

You can find all information about patch 10.1 for World of Warcraft in our overview here. In the video, you can see the latest cinematic:

Start video
New WoW Cinematic shows the power of the incarnations and quite dark figures

Players are excluded to make the fight easier

Blizzard gives no reason why the ability was removed. However, colleagues from wowhead report that some raid groups have already considered which players to intentionally abandon.

Since some of the Class Calls would be significantly harder than others, they would just leave out the corresponding classes – and instead include many of those whose effect is particularly easy.

Since Blizzard has represented the philosophy “bring the Player, not the Class” for many years, the decision here is obvious. Even in the comments, some fans show disappointment, but secretly they are relieved.

Particularly effects like that of the druid, which transforms him into a random form every 6 seconds, would have been more annoying than a challenge. Especially for “casual” groups, the ability would have simply been too cumbersome.
